Apartments with WiFi Postup, Peljesac - 23780 isin Orebić. The air-conditioned accommodation is 1.5 km from Beach Ovrata, and guests can benefit from on-site private parking and complimentary WiFi.
The spacious apartment with a terrace and sea views features 1 bedroom, a living room, a TV, an equipped kitchen with a fridge and a stovetop, and 1 bathroom with a shower. For added privacy, the accommodation features a private entrance.
The hotel day starts from hour 14:00 and ends at 10:00.
This property will not accommodate hen, stag or similar parties.
One-Bedroom Apartment with Terrace and Sea View. Boasting a private entrance, this spacious apartment also includes 1 living room, 1 separate bedroom and 1 bathroom with a shower. Guests can make meals in the kitchen that is fitted with a stovetop, a refrigerator and kitchenware. Featuring a terrace with sea views, this apartment also offers air conditioning and a TV. The unit has 2 beds.
